Recognizing EPDM Rubber's Exceptional Weather Resistance

EPDM rubber is widely recognized for its exceptional weather resistance. This sturdy material can withstand a epdm rubber variety of harsh weather conditions, including extreme cold, UV radiation from the sun, and even moisture. Its chemical makeup allows it to remain flexible and resistant to cracking or degrading over time. This makes EPDM rubber an ideal choice for roofing materials, window seals, automotive parts, and many other applications where exposure to the elements is a concern.

Exploring EPDM Rubber's Many Roles

EPDM rubber, a versatile synthetic material renowned for its exceptional durability and resistance to environmental factors, finds utilization in a wide range of industries. Its remarkable performance characteristics have made it an integral component in both construction and manufacturing sectors. In the construction industry, EPDM rubber is widely employed for roofing membranes, offering durable protection against moisture and UV radiation. Its flexibility and resistance to extreme temperatures make it an ideal material for sealing joints and preventing leaks in various structures.

Within the manufacturing sector, EPDM rubber plays a vital role in producing a range of products. It is commonly used to manufacture gaskets, seals, and hoses due to its exceptional durability. Furthermore, EPDM rubber's resistance to ozone and weathering provides it suitable for outdoor applications such as automotive parts and playground equipment.

Optimizing Performance with EPDM Rubber: Factors Affecting Durability

EPDM rubber is renowned for its exceptional durability and resilience, making it a popular choice in various applications. Nevertheless, several factors can influence the longevity of EPDM rubber components. Comprehending these factors is crucial for maximizing the performance and lifespan of EPDM products.

One key factor is exposure to UV radiation. Prolonged exposure can cause degradation, leading to cracking and loss of elasticity. Furthermore, temperature fluctuations can also stress the rubber, leading dimensional changes and reduced strength.

It's important to select EPDM rubber compounds with appropriate additives and reinforcement materials that offer protection against these external factors. Furthermore, proper installation and maintenance practices can significantly extend the lifespan of EPDM components.
